We are seeking a Campaign Manager to join the team.. The ideal candidate will have experience in campaign management and content production, with a proven track record of executing successful marketing initiatives. As a Campaign Manager, you will be responsible for overseeing the end-to-end production process of brand & marketing campaigns and creative content, ensuring that all projects are delivered on time, within budget, and to the highest quality standards.
Main Accountabilities…
Support the wider demand creation team to deliver the objectives for Wonderskin;
Campaign Management: Lead the planning, execution, and optimisation of multi-channel brand & marketing campaigns to drive awareness, customer acquisition, retention and engagement. Own the Campaign / Trading Calendar/s
Content Production: Collaborate with internal teams and external partners to develop engaging and on-brand content across various platforms and customer touch points, including social media, our eCom store, B2B sales channels and paid advertising and CRM, setting and working within campaign budgets;
Creative feedback: Provide creative guidance to graphic designers, copywriters, videographers, and other creative professionals to ensure that all content aligns with brand guidelines and resonates with the target audience;
Performance Analysis: working closely with the wider demand creation functions, monitor and analyse the performance of campaigns and content, using data-driven insights to optimise future strategies and tactics;
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work closely with cross-functional teams, including marketing, product development, and customer service, to align campaign objectives with overall business goals;
Chair / Lead meetings / ideation sessions with Product, Brand, Marketing & Trading to populate the campaign calendar;
Where possible, be the catalyst / devise campaigns with the aim of hitting Wonderskin objectives;
Vendor Management: Evaluate and onboard external vendors, such as agencies and freelancers, as needed to support campaign and content production efforts;
Compliance and Legal: Ensure that all marketing materials and campaigns comply with Alcohol industry regulations and legal requirements in each market;
Keep up to date with campaign & content best practice of tomorrow through training and research etc;
Positively impact and influence internal stakeholders and external partners;
Effectively communicate and collaborate with all our stakeholders and wider group team;
Uphold and consistently narrative the strategy set out in our brand playbooks;
Think like a customer, all the time, every day.
